How much does training at Dang Muay Thai in Chiang Mai cost?
Training at Dang Muay Thai in Chiang Mai costs ฿450 (approximately $14 USD) for a drop-in session, making it excellent value for casual visitors. For those staying longer, monthly memberships are available at ฿5,500 (around $169 USD), which offers significant savings for regular training. All equipment can be rented on-site for an additional fee.
What is the best time of day to train at this Chiang Mai Muay Thai gym?
Weekday mornings between 8-10AM typically offer a quieter training environment with more personalised attention. If you prefer a vibrant atmosphere with more energy, afternoon sessions from 3-5PM are busier. Sundays have limited hours (9AM-3PM) and fewer classes.
Do I need to book in advance for a Muay Thai session in Chiang Mai's old city?
While drop-ins are welcome, it's advisable to book ahead during peak tourist season (November-February) when classes fill quickly. You can easily reserve a spot via WhatsApp, phone, or through their website. First-timers should arrive 15-20 minutes early to complete paperwork.
